在皮肤对皮肤护理期间,母亲垂直微生物传播
Maryam Hamidi1, Angelica Cruz-Lebrón, Naseer Sangwan
1Frances Bolton School of Nursing (Dr Hamidi), Department of Molecular Biology and Microbiology (Drs Cruz-Lebrón and Levine), and Departments of Pharmacology, Pathology, Medicine, and Pediatrics (Dr Levine), Case Western Reserve University, Cleveland, Ohio; Department of Cardiovascular and Metabolic Sciences, Cleveland Clinic Foundation, Cleveland, Ohio (Dr Sangwan); Neonatal Intensive Care Unit, Rainbow Babies & Children's Hospital, University Hospitals Cleveland Medical Center, Cleveland, Ohio (Dr Blatz).
皮肤对皮肤 (STS) 护理丰富了早产婴儿的微生物组. 增加STS暴露对垂直微生物传播产生积极影响,调节口腔和肠道微生物平衡,改善婴儿肠道健康.

背景情况:
- 皮肤对皮肤 (STS) 护理因其对早产婴儿的益处而得到认可.
- STS护理可能会促进母婴垂直微生物传播.
- 丰富早产婴儿的微生物组是STS护理的潜在结果.
研究的目的:
- 调查皮肤对皮肤 (STS) 护理持续时间增加对垂直微生物传播的影响.
- 确定STS护理如何调节早产婴儿的口腔和肠道微生物平衡.
- 定义STS暴露和微生物群落组成之间的关系.
主要方法:
- 涉及产后妇女和早产婴儿 (31-34周妊娠期) 的观察性研究.
- 16S rRNA测序用于分析母体皮肤,婴儿口腔和婴儿便中的微生物群落.
- 微生物多样性 (α-和β-多样性) 和相对丰度在低 (<40分钟) 和高 (>60分钟) STS暴露组之间的比较.
主要成果:
- 微生物的组成,多样性和丰度在母体皮肤,婴儿口腔和婴儿便样本中显著不同.
- 高STS暴露的早产婴儿显示口腔微生物丰富度降低,但便丰富度增加.
- 观察到口腔和肠道微生物多样性和组成的显著差异,特定的属 (Gemella,Aggregatibacter) 和一个家族 (Lachnospiraceae) 在高STS组的便中更为丰富.
结论:
- 皮肤对皮肤 (STS) 护理似乎是增强早产婴儿微生物群落的有效策略.
- 增加STS护理持续时间会影响垂直微生物传播和婴儿微生物组的发展.
- 研究结果支持使用STS护理来促进脆弱的早产人口中更强大的微生物群.
